摘要

Performance evaluations of parallel and distributed systems are complex due to the properties of concurrency, fault tolerance and degradability. Stochastic Activity Networks (SANs) provide a powerful modeling environment, which makes evaluation of such systems a fairly straightforward process. This motivates the use of modeling techniques for Performance evaluation. In this paper, we study the performance evaluation of such complex systems, using SANs models. The simulation models and results are presented and discussed here.
